• Crackear la librería termsrv de Windows

    Si tu versión de Windows no te permite realizar múltiples conexiones simultaneas al servidor de escritorio remoto de Windows, necesitas parchear la librería termsrv.dll. Para ello sigue los siguientes pasos:

    1 – Haz una copia de seguridad del archivo dll antes de modificarlo. Para ello abre un cmd como Administrador y ejecuta:

    copy c:\Windows\System32\termsrv.dll termsrv.dll_backup

    2 – Haz al Administrador propietario del archivo dll ejecutando:

    takeown /F c:\Windows\System32\termsrv.dll /A

    3 – Garantiza a los administradores locales el control del archivo dll ejecutando:

    icacls c:\Windows\System32\termsrv.dll /grant Administrators:F

    4 – Para el servicio de escritorio remoto ejecutando:

    Net stop TermService

     

    5 – Averigua que versión de Windows 10 tienes ejecutando en powershell lo siguiente:

    (Get-ItemProperty "HKLM:\SOFTWARE\Microsoft\Windows NT\CurrentVersion").DisplayVersion

    6 – Dependiendo de la versión que tengas deberás reemplazar en el archivo dll la cadena hexadecimal de abajo por la versión correspondiente según lo siguiente:

    v21H1 buscar 39813C0600000F84DB610100 y reemplazar por B80001000089813806000090
    v1909 buscar 39813C0600000F845D610100 y reemplazar por B80001000089813806000090
    v1903 buscar 39813C0600000F845D610100 y reemplazar por B80001000089813806000090
    v1809 buscar 39813C0600000F843B2B0100 y reemplazar por B80001000089813806000090
    v1803 buscar 8B993C0600008BB938060000 y reemplazar por B80001000089813806000090
    v1709 buscar 39813C0600000F84B17D0200 y reemplazar por B80001000089813806000090

    x